Oracle 11gR2数据库ASM与OHAS日常维护指南

1 下载量 176 浏览量 更新于2024-06-27 收藏 103KB DOC 举报
Oracle 11gR2数据库系统是Oracle公司推出的一个强大且功能丰富的数据库管理系统,它引入了许多新特性,优化了日常维护流程。此操作手册详细介绍了如何进行系统的日常维护,包括ASM(Automatic Storage Management)管理、OHAS(Oracle High Availability Services)服务管理、表空间管理以及重做日志管理。 2.1 ASM管理与监控 ASM是Oracle 11gR2中的一个重要组件,用于自动管理数据库的存储。ASM能够自动配置、扩展和维护磁盘组,提高存储的可用性和性能。以下是ASM管理的一些关键操作: - 磁盘创建(Linux):在Linux环境下,ASM通过ASMLib(Automatic Storage Management Library)在内核级别管理磁盘,使得ASM实例可以轻松识别并管理磁盘。 - 查看磁盘:使用特定的命令可以检查ASM识别到的磁盘状态。 - 删除磁盘:当需要移除不再使用的磁盘时,ASM提供了相应的操作步骤。 - 创建磁盘组:ASM允许用户创建新的磁盘组,以存储数据库的数据文件和控制文件。 - 磁盘组添加/删除磁盘:在磁盘组中增加或减少磁盘容量,以适应存储需求的变化。 - 磁盘组删除:如果不再需要某个磁盘组,可以通过ASM删除它。 - 磁盘组维护:包括调整磁盘组的属性、扩展或缩小磁盘组大小等。 - 磁盘组监控:ASM提供监控工具来跟踪磁盘组的性能和健康状况。 2.2 OHAS服务管理与监控 OHAS是Oracle Restart的一部分,用于管理和监控数据库相关的服务,如ASM实例、数据库实例和监听器。其关键操作包括: - 启/禁用服务资源:根据需要启动或禁用数据库相关服务。 - 启动/停止资源服务:控制数据库服务的启动和停止,确保服务的可用性。 - 监控/删除资源服务:定期检查服务状态,并在必要时删除不再需要的服务。 2.3 表空间管理与监控 表空间是数据库中存储数据的主要单元,包括管理表空间的创建、修改和监控: - 表空间管理:创建新的表空间,扩展或收缩已有的表空间,以及设置表空间的属性。 - 表空间监控:监视表空间的使用情况,以防止空间不足导致的问题。 2.4 重做日记管理 重做日志是Oracle数据库的重要组成部分,记录所有事务对数据库的更改。这包括: - 日记维护:确保重做日志的正常流转,避免日志文件满导致的数据库停止写入。 - 定制日记保存策略:根据系统需求调整日记的保存时间和位置。 2.5 日记维护 - 定制GRID模块日记保存策略:针对GRID组件,设定日记保存规则。 - 定制RDBMS模块日记保存策略:对于RDBMS部分,同样可以定制日记保存策略。 - 查看异常日记:监控并分析可能存在的错误或异常日记条目。 - 手工清理日记:在必要时手动清理旧的、不再需要的日记文件,释放存储空间。 总结来说,Oracle 11gR2数据库系统的日常维护操作手册涵盖了ASM的全面管理,OHAS服务监控,表空间的维护,重做日志管理等核心任务,旨在帮助数据库管理员高效、安全地运行和维护数据库系统。这些操作的详细说明有助于提升系统的稳定性和性能,同时减少了可能出现的问题和故障。